A mere nine mile leap across the ocean from its neighbour to the north, Spain, Morocco is one of only three countries with both Atlantic and Mediterranean coasts, while its interior is a study in aridity replete with dunes, rocks and sand. Its cultural influences – Arab, Berber, French, Jewish, and Spanish – contribute to its uniqueness among North African neighbouring nations. The legendary cities of Casablanca, Marrakesh, Tangier, and Fes host bustling spice markets and remarkably stunning mosques and hammams, drawing thousands of European vacationers. Cell phones and motorcycles remind travellers of its modernization, but Morocco still holds a patina of times past.

WHAT TO DO IN YOUR SPARE TIME IN MOROCCO
In your spare time in Morocco, there are plenty of enjoyable activities and experiences to pursue. Here are some suggestions:
- Explore the Medina: Wander through the narrow streets of the medinas (old town) and discover bustling souks, historic landmarks, and vibrant local culture.
- Experience the Sahara Desert: Take a desert excursion, where you can ride camels, watch stunning sunsets over the dunes, and stargaze under the clear night sky.
- Try Moroccan Cuisine: Indulge in delicious Moroccan dishes like tagine, couscous, pastilla, and Moroccan mint tea at local restaurants and cafes.
- Trek in the Atlas Mountains: Explore picturesque valleys, traditional Berber villages, and stunning mountain landscapes.

Morocco FAQs
Is Morocco a Muslim Country?
Yes, Morocco is predominately Muslim, with 99.9% identifying as Sunni Muslim.
What Should You Wear in Morocco?
In Morocco, opt for modest and respectful clothing, particularly in traditional and rural areas. Choose loose-fitting clothes that cover shoulders, cleavage, and knees for women; men should also avoid revealing attire. Pack layers for varying climates, comfortable shoes, and consider a scarf for head coverings at religious sites. In beach areas, swimwear is acceptable, but remember to cover up outside those areas. Adapting to local customs and wearing traditional clothing is appreciated, and be mindful of cultural sensitivity.
How Far is Morocco from Spain?
Morocco is located on the northwest coast of Africa and is separated from Spain by the Strait of Gibraltar. The distance between the two countries is approximately 8 miles.
When is the Best Time to Visit Morocco?
The best time to visit Morocco is usually between March and May or September to November. These months offer the best combination of pleasant temperatures and lower rainfall. This is also when the country is least crowded, meaning you’ll be able to experience the full beauty of Morocco without the hustle and bustle of the peak tourist season. However, Morrocco has much to offer throughout the year.
Is Morocco Safe?
Morocco is generally safe for tourists. Watch for petty theft in crowded areas, respect local customs, and use reputable transportation. Be cautious of scams and stay informed about travel advisories and health precautions.
